Craft as Political Art. Public and personal histories woven in a kilim.
What is a Kilim, what it represented and what does it stand for now? Visual artist Loukia Richards retraces the origins of the hand-woven kilim, a carpet that she has always seen on the floor of her family home in Leonidio, Greece, and that sparked her interest in the political and social value of craftsmanship.
